DESCRIPTION:UNCTAD is organizing its first Non-Tariff Measures Week to have
  comprehensive and intensive discussion on this topic. The NTMs Week has a
  diverse programme for three days with policy discussions\, recent economi
 c research findings\, the annual meeting of the Multi Agency Support Team 
 (MAST)\, and a look towards voluntary sustainable standards. \n\nRegulati
 ons and standards are a main hurdle to trade. Business surveys as well as 
 quantitative assessments show that with falling tariffs\, NTMs have become
  the more important impediment to trade. Challenges include costs of compl
 iance and in particular the lack of transparency. At the same time\, many 
 regulations and standards provide benefits for consumer protection and oth
 er sustainable development objectives. \n\nThe meeting on mandatory trade
  regulations and MAST takes place during the first two days of the NTMs we
 ek. The meeting sheds light on the importance of NTMs on international tra
 de and development\, and shows successful global and regional approaches t
 o tackle the challenges including transparency initiatives and regulatory 
 cooperation. \n\nMoreover\, the MAST meeting follows up on the September 
 2015 and October 2016 Expert Meetings on NTMs to take stock of the policy 
 agenda and the further development and revision of the NTMs Classification
 . The International Classification of NTMs developed by MAST has become a 
 common language for the international trade community\, including for rese
 archers\, regional and international organizations as well as governments.
 \n\nThis was the first step towards enhancing transparency and understandi
 ng of NTMs. Significant effort has also been made in the subsequent global
  and comprehensive mapping of NTMs by UNCTAD and its partners. The current
  database covers over 80% of world trade and these efforts go hand-in-hand
  with capacity building.\n\nThe global database on Non-Tariff Measures: ht
